TECHNICAL DATA SHEET - EN25 & EN 25

Material category: low alloy steel with high tensile
Technical specifications: BS970 Part 3
Special melting: EAF + :LF + VD, + ESR
Typical chemical compositions (mass weight - %)
Carbon, C (%): 0.27 ~ 0.35
Manganese, Mn (%): 0.45 ~ 0.70
Silicon, Si (%): 0.10 ~ 0.35
Phosphorus, P (%): ≤ 0.035
Sulfur, S (%): ≤ 0.015
Chromium, Cr (%): 0.50 ~ 0.80
Nickel, Ni (%): 2.30 ~ 2.80
Molybdenum, Mo (%): 0.40 ~ 0.70
 
MECHANICAL PROPERTY AND HARDNESS
Quenching temperature /℃: 860, oil
Tempering temperature /℃: 600, water or oil
Tensile strength, Rm ≥ MPa: 980
Yield strength, Rp0.2 ≥ MPa: 835
Elongation, A5 ≥ (%): 12.0
Reduction of area, Z ≥ (%): 55.0
Hardness in annealed condition: HB269 max.
 
MELTING PROCESS & APPLICATION
This
alloy is generally smelt in Electric Arc Furnace  (EAF), EAF+LF+VD, BEF + Electroslag remelting (ESR). For a purpose of superior quality, it should be smelt via technology of vacuum refining or by agreement. It is suitable for applications such as high tensile shafts, bolts and nuts, gears, pinions spindles and so on.
